Abstract :
The Ni–P and Ni–P–PTFE coatings were deposited on mild carbon steel surface via electroless deposition process. The as-deposited coatings were characterized through XRD, SEM, and EDS. The electrochemical anticorrosion behaviors of the coatings in natural seawater were investigated by measurements of potentiodynamic polarization curves, open circuit potential, and electrochemical impedance spectra. The results showed that by immersion in natural seawater for 3–7 days the Ni–P and Ni–P–PTFE coatings could provide maximum protection for the substrate. With regard to the PTFE incorporation, the coating with large amount of PTFE possessed a porous microstructure and hence poor electrochemical anticorrosion performance. Concerning the effect of the ocean microorganisms noticeable variations on electrochemical parameters have been observed though reliable consequence was yet to draw via cultivation and breeding of the ocean microorganisms in subsequent work.
